Pexels offers over 3 million free stock videos and photos, all licensed under the Pexels License — which means you can use them commercially, in social media content, without attribution, and without watermarks. For creators building faceless channels or brands that don't have budget for original filming, it's the best free resource available.

Some niches work much better with stock footage than others. These are the categories where Pexels' library is deepest and the content performs best:
Wide shots of people in motion — walking, working, exercising, cooking — are the most versatile clips in any library. They work as a neutral backdrop for almost any hook text, regardless of niche. Search "person working", "woman walking city", "man gym" for reliable, reusable footage.
Pexels clips are free for commercial use under the Pexels License. You can use them in monetized content, brand promotions, and paid social ads without paying licensing fees or crediting the original creator. This makes them genuinely different from YouTube stock footage or random video you find online.
One thing to note: Pexels clips may occasionally feature recognizable people. While the Pexels License covers most use cases, if you're using a clip featuring a recognizable individual in a way that implies their endorsement of a product, it's worth checking the specific clip's model release status. For standard B-roll content marketing use, this is rarely an issue.
